1) Major Holders of Treas Securities:

Unlike what some people on twitter are saying, it is actually money market funds along with the Fed that are the major buyers of Treasury securities over the past year; NOT the banks who are in a distant 3rd.
2) Major Holders of Treas Securities:

Although the banks are increasing their holdings, they are doing so from a small base. Here is a historical chart (up to 2020-Q2) of the major holders of Treas securities.

Banks were the major holder in the '50s & '60s. Now, not so much.
3) Major Holders of Treas Securities:

For all US depository institutions (banks) their treasury security holdings are 4.8% of total assets as of 2020-Q2.
